Flute, Oboe, Bassoon, Clarinet in Bb 1, Clarinet in Bb 2, Bass Clarinet, Alto Saxophone 1, Alto Saxophone 2, Tenor Saxophone, Baritone Saxophone, Trumpet in Bb 1, Trumpet in Bb 2, Horn in F, Trombone 1, Trombone 2, Euphonium, Bb Euphonium, Tuba, Mallet Percussion, Bells, Xylophone, Percussion 1, Snare Drum, Bass Drum, Percussion 2, Triangle, Suspended Cymbal, Wind Chimes, Percussion 3, Tambourine, Wood Block — Forza means strength in Italian. The piece should be played in an aggressive manner. Special attention must be given to the accents throughout the piece, especially in the percussion section. The xylophone part is very important and must be heard. Pay close attention to all dynamics. In the Andante doloroso section (m. 47), the mood should be melancholy. Play with an abundance of emotion.Forza was commissioned by the school District of Greenville County (Greenville, South Carolina) for the 2022 Junior All-County Band. Forza means strength. This forceful and aggressive piece uses dynamics and articulations to musically depict strength and fortitude. Accents are used for emphatic effect, particularly in the percussion, and the middle andante section offers a contrasting melancholy mood.
